Raising Awareness

Firstly, food safety slogans are incredibly effective at *raising awareness*. In a world saturated with information, getting people to remember and understand complex ideas can be challenging. Slogans offer a way to distill essential messages into easily digestible forms. Consider the slogan, “Wash your hands, don’t take chances.” This simple phrase immediately communicates the importance of hand hygiene, a fundamental aspect of food safety. The ease with which such phrases can be absorbed is a major advantage; they embed themselves in our consciousness with minimal effort, serving as constant reminders of best practices.

Changing Behavior

Secondly, food safety slogans play a key role in *changing behavior*. People often know the rules but don’t always put them into practice. Slogans can be a powerful motivator. They’re designed to prompt action and encourage adherence to guidelines. Phrases such as, “Chill out! Keep it cold,” act as a direct prompt to ensure proper food storage. They cut through the excuses and urge immediate action, encouraging responsible choices in the heat of the moment. By repeating these messages, they become part of our everyday decision-making process.

Crafting Effective Food Safety Slogans

The effectiveness of a food safety slogan depends heavily on how it’s crafted. A good slogan is much more than just a collection of words.

Conciseness

The most effective slogans are short and to the point. They convey the message quickly, using minimal words. Clarity is essential. The ideal slogan should be easy to grasp, requiring little or no explanation.

Memorability

A good slogan is catchy, easy to remember, and easy to recall. This is often achieved through the use of rhythm, rhyme, or a memorable phrase. Consider how effective it is to use repetition, or even wordplay.

Action-Oriented

Slogans should encourage specific actions. They should tell people what to do, not just what not to do. It’s about motivating people to act and follow safety measures.

Positive Framing

Focus on the positive aspects of food safety. Encourage and emphasize the good results of proper food practices.

Plain Language

Avoid using technical jargon or complex language that might confuse the audience. The purpose is to deliver a clear message that everyone can understand.

Target Audience

Recognize the audience for which the slogans are intended. A slogan intended for children should use different language than one targeting food service professionals. Understanding the target group helps craft a more compelling message.

Types of Food Safety Slogans

The realm of food safety is broad, so the slogans that we use need to address various areas to communicate all the aspects of keeping food safe. Some areas for food safety slogans include the following:

Hand Hygiene is Essential

  • “Hands clean = safe eat.” This succinctly highlights the link between clean hands and food safety.
  • “Scrub-a-dub-dub, wash your hands before the grub.” This employs rhyme and a familiar phrase to make the message memorable.
  • “Wash your hands, keep germs at bay.” This is a straightforward and directive call to action.

Proper Preparation Matters

  • “Cook it right, bite by bite!” This emphasizes the importance of thorough cooking to kill bacteria.
  • “Internal temp is a must, for a meal you can trust.” It stresses the importance of using a thermometer to ensure food is cooked to a safe temperature.
  • “Don’t cross the line, keep foods apart.” This encourages the prevention of cross-contamination.

Proper Storage for Safety

  • “Keep it cold, don’t let it fold.” This promotes the importance of refrigeration for preserving food.
  • “In the fridge is the fridge’s best place.” This is another straightforward message about proper refrigeration.
  • “Refrigerate promptly, that’s the key.” Emphasizes the necessity of refrigerating food quickly after preparation or purchase.

Food Label Awareness

  • “Look, Read, Protect.” This promotes the importance of understanding the food label and its information.
  • “Read it before you eat it.” A direct instruction on the necessity of reading a food label.

General Awareness of Food Safety

  • “Safe food, happy people.” This highlights the benefits of food safety for the public’s wellbeing.
  • “Food safety is everyone’s duty.” It stresses that everyone is accountable for food safety practices.
  • “Don’t be a risk-taker, be a food-safety shaker.” Encourages people to adopt responsible food handling practices.

“Clean. Separate. Cook. Chill,” is a well-known slogan from the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A). This concise, four-step guideline is a prime example of how a simple message can capture key aspects of food safety. The phrase is easy to remember and directly correlates to essential actions, making it a valuable resource for consumers and professionals alike.
